Job Duties
- Coordinate with training officer, training NCO, squadron aviation resource management, Unit Deployment Manager, and Operations Officer to arrange schedules
- Build long- and short-range shift schedules ensuring full coverage
- Coordinate with senior squadron leadership and simulator contractors
- Track crewmember leave, temporary duty, and scheduling commitments, de-conflict schedules
- Track daily flight, ground, academic training requirements and accomplishments
- Facilitate last-minute schedule changes ensuring full coverage
- Publish and post scheduling data for training event schedules
- Comply with Ops Group and Wing Current Operations and Group Training guidance
- Perform daily updates of scheduling data
- Coordinate with outside agencies and higher headquarters for exercises and special events
- Provide inputs to Wing Scheduling and Current Operations meetings
- Produce Flight Authorizations cleared through Group Stan/Eval Go-No/Go process
- Update Load Tracker for next week’s schedule
- Produce Flying Hour Program Report
- Provide weekly JPAS requirements to security manager
- Coordinate with Aerial Delivery, Training, Loadmaster Scheduler, and Wing Scheduling for training loads assignment
